The pressure to get that dream internship can be intense, but perseverance is the key to sustain oneself, says Debashis
Success demands trading lofty comfort zone pleasures with diligent effort. As a firm believer of this ideology, I have been a very driven and proactive person throughout my life and have believed in the power of hard work coupled with a generous dose of persistence in creating wonders.
The pressure to get that coveted dream internship can be intense, but perseverance is the key to sustain oneself. I always wanted to bag the role of Sales and Marketing Intern in a leading FMCG firm. The first day of internship was jam-packed with companies and ITC was the first one for which I interviewed.
My project involves enhancing our rural sales by penetrating the market using alternate sales channels. This assignment was both challenging as well as interesting because I had to create a new channel of sales without the help of traditional/ regular manpower. My prime focus was to find such markets in rural areas where we are not giving service directly (secondary sales), analyze the market potential & nominate them in the list of the to-be service markets.

Second part of this assignment was to find such SHGs (self-help groups) of that location who are having such members who are willing to try their luck in Direct selling, enroll them as our channel partners, train them the basics of like product knowledge, pricing & sales techniques. This assignment helped us to reach our untapped consumers directly, as they were not having exposure to our brands.
It was a surreal moment for me when I got a PPO offer from ITC. The internship taught me two important things. First, there are times when you would have to work on many things at the same time, then it becomes very important to get your priorities right and stay focused. Second, the quality of your recommendation lies in the quality of questions you ask. So, work a lot on the questions you are asking from the stakeholders of your project.
